> What are people's thoughts on how to place movement numbers in a piece?
>
> Each movement will of course have its own score{} context.  The obvious
> choice is to use piece="I" in the associated header{}, but this prints
> in the wrong place -- on the left-hand-side -- and is clearly intended
> instead for the kind of movement names such as 'Cavatina', 'Overtura'
> etc. as in a Beethoven string quartet score I have to hand, which appear
> on the left-hand-side above the tempo instructions.
>
> On the other hand, subtitle="I" doesn't work inside a header{} that is
> inside the score{} context.
>
> I can redefine the scoreTitleMarkup structure to get 'piece' to display
> as I wish, but movement numbers displayed centre-aligned at the top of
> the score are such a common feature that I can't help feeling that I
> must be missing something.  Am I ... ?
